How to fill out quotdeveloping a born-digital preservation:

01
Start by understanding the importance of born-digital preservation. This involves recognizing the value of preserving digital content, such as documents, images, videos, and audio files, in its original digital form.
02
Identify the specific goals and objectives of your born-digital preservation project. This may include ensuring the long-term accessibility, integrity, and authenticity of the digital content.
03
Assess your organization's current infrastructure and resources. Evaluate the existing systems, software, and hardware available for managing and preserving digital content. Determine if any upgrades or additional tools are needed.
04
Establish a clear workflow for born-digital preservation. This includes defining roles and responsibilities, establishing guidelines for capturing and ingesting digital content, implementing metadata standards, and defining quality control processes.
05
Develop a comprehensive preservation strategy. This may involve selecting appropriate file formats, creating backup and recovery plans, implementing migration or emulation strategies, and considering the use of metadata preservation standards.
06
Consider legal and ethical considerations related to born-digital preservation. This includes understanding copyright issues, privacy concerns, and the need for secure storage and access controls for sensitive content.
07
Train staff members on the proper procedures for born-digital preservation. Ensure that they understand the importance of preserving digital content and are familiar with the tools and processes involved.
08
Regularly review and update your born-digital preservation plan. As technology evolves, it is important to stay current with best practices and adapt your strategies as needed.

Who needs quotdeveloping a born-digital preservation:

01
Libraries and archives: Libraries and archives often hold valuable born-digital collections, such as digital manuscripts, photographs, and audio recordings. Developing a born-digital preservation plan is essential to ensure the long-term accessibility and preservation of these digital materials.
02
Government agencies: Government agencies generate and manage a significant amount of born-digital records and data. Developing a born-digital preservation plan is crucial for ensuring the authenticity and integrity of these records, as well as complying with legal and regulatory requirements.
03
Museums and cultural heritage organizations: Museums and cultural heritage organizations often have digital collections comprising artworks, artifacts, and historical documents. Establishing a born-digital preservation plan is necessary to safeguard these digital assets and enable future access and research.
